Transaction f59f4a196b62e2c4bd3a81eaea30e8d7380a47c86751d8a99a2931e123662891

1 Input
1 Outputs
  • f59f4a196b62e2c4bd3a81eaea30e8d7380a47c86751d8a99a2931e123662891:0
  • value  310507
    address  39MSsAnGCqsixmkB4KngR7yVY3ggDouaVd